TORM plc, a shipping company, owns and operates a fleet of product tankers in the United Kingdom and internationally. It operates in two segments, Tanker and Marine Engineering.
The Tanker segment transports refined oil products, such as gasoline, jet fuel, diesel, naphtha, and gas oil, as well as dirty petroleum products, such as residual fuels and crude oil. The Marine Engineering segment engages in developing and producing advanced and green marine equipment. Founded in 1889, TORM is based in London, the United Kingdom.

Where is TORM plc listed and in which currency?
TORM plc is listed on the NasdaqGS exchange under the ticker symbol TRMD. Its financials are reported in US dollars (USD), reflecting its international operations and the standard currency for shipping and oil trading. The company is incorporated in the United Kingdom and has a global presence, but its stock trades on a US exchange, making it accessible to investors worldwide.
What sector and industry does TORM plc belong to?
TORM plc operates in the Energy sector, specifically within the Oil & Gas Midstream industry. This means the company is involved in the transportation, storage, and handling of oil and gas products, rather than exploration or production. As a midstream player, TORM focuses on shipping refined petroleum products and crude oil via its tanker fleet, bridging the gap between upstream producers and downstream consumers.
